Output 13659c26530149cec57563f8580b2f24cb2a0a45cd455f9bd9581a310d00a7ec:0

value
89035
script pubkey
OP_0 OP_PUSHBYTES_20 f93c84f184c862f00e54d7d67a4c95d0e525861b
address
bc1qly7gfuvyep30qrj56lt85ny46rjjtpsmverv44
transaction
13659c26530149cec57563f8580b2f24cb2a0a45cd455f9bd9581a310d00a7ec
spent
true